What is the definition of a neutron?

Respuesta :

samridhakavya samridhakavya
  • 02-12-2019

Answer:

neutron is a subatomic particle of about the same mass as a proton but without an electric charge, present in all atomic nuclei except those of ordinary hydrogen.
